In stock 24 Products
Helena Rubinstein
In stock 67 Products
In stock 67 Products
Olay
In stock 44 Products
In stock 44 Products
Elizabeth Arden
In stock 148 Products
Cetaphil
In stock 227 Products
Estee Lauder
In stock 10 Products
L'Oreal Make Up
In stock 24 Products
Helena Rubinstein
In stock 67 Products
In stock 67 Products
Olay
In stock 44 Products
In stock 44 Products
Elizabeth Arden
In stock 148 Products
Cetaphil
In stock 227 Products
Estee Lauder
In stock 10 Products
L'Oreal Make Up
Wishlist is empty.